Allianz Stadium
won a Landscape Architecture Award in the Urban Design category. The panel commended the design's focus on the public domain, and iterative design process. Sustainability and biodiversity were prioritised to create a unique and high-quality space.

The Canterbury Bankstown Project also picked up a Landscape Architecture Award in the Small Projects category. This project challenged traditional streetscape design in the aftermath of Covid-19 lockdowns and was celebrated for its playful approach.

Quay Quarter Lanes was an Excellence Award winner in the Civic Landscapes category. The jury praised the project as a 'seamless response which retains its integrity and will be loved by the city for decades to come'.

Lastly, South Eveleigh was an Excellence Award winner in the Urban Design category. Our design was commended as a "shining example of sustainable urban design … that creates a thriving community" which caters to a diverse mix of locals and workers.
